私は内部でフラッシュを使用するWRTアプリケーションをやっています。ことは、私はJavaScriptを介してSWFにパラメータを渡す必要があります。だから私はFlash/JavaScriptとWRTのExternalInterfaceに関する問題
function returnFunction() { return "test"; }
のようにJavaScriptの関数を作成し、私のSWFに私は次のコードを持っている:私は私のローカルマシン上で実行した場合
import flash.external.ExternalInterface;
var result:Object = ExternalInterface.call("returnFunction");
versionTxt.text = "Returned: " + String(result);
だから、これは正常に動作を(持っていましたフラッシュプレーヤーのセキュリティを変更する)と私はそれをサーバー上でホストします。ので、私はここではオプションの外だナル
を:返さ
:しかし、私は携帯電話でそれを実行する必要があるので、私はWRTアプリでそれを包み、私はそれをテストするとき、それは次のように返します。それはセキュリティ上の問題ですか?私はすでにWRTで実行されているようなものを見たと思うので、私はそれが可能であると確信しているだけで、私はここで紛失しているものは分かっていない:/
問題は、あなたはそれが動作(通信のもう一つの "層" を追加した)と言っているようならば、それをやるということですデスクトップでうまくいく。しかし、モバイルではそうではありません。だから、セキュリティ上の問題か、.Flaの設定に欠けていると思います –